Position Purpose:

Serve as liaison with contracted pest control providers and PETCO field staff to assure all stores are complying with housekeeping standards and services to keep our stores pest free and our pets safe.

Essential Job Functions:
The incumbent must be able to perform all of the following duties and responsibilities with or without a reasonable accommodation.
  • Daily address calls and emails from stores and service providers to answer urgent issues and compliance concerns. Interact daily with store managers, district managers and leadership on issues related to pest control issues.
  • Daily oversee services provided by pest control service providers to insure all issues at the stores are resolved within a 24hr timeframe.
  • Develop metrics to track pest control service provider’s performance and recommend corrective action. Track trends and service compliance with PETCO Pest Control program.
  • Identify the proper path for resolving Pest Control issues. Determine if this issue requires maintenance department notification and involvement and/or if the issue is sensitive and must be escalated to management or if Risk Management or Animal Care staff need to be involved.
  • Coordinate with facilities or store maintenance on any repairs required to maintain compliance of PETCO Pest Control program.
  • Meet quarterly with pest control service providers to evaluate performance and address any areas of risk.
